Big Rock wont blow you away but are an important figure in the scene. Wild Rose does good things for our city, and Village Brewery is starting to produce tasty stuff too (try their Wit). Your best bets for good beer downtown are:
- Hop n Brew (the best)
- Beer Revolution (good pizza, good beer list)
- National Beer Hall (kinda meh but maybe worthwhile)
- Wurst (lots of German stuff on tap, good German food)
Best beer stores:
- Kensington wine market
- Willow Park Liquor
- Bin 905
